Default oxygen concentrator problems...

Ok so i just bought an EX-15 oxygen concentrator an when its pluged and running the presure is not stable. The machine make some pssshhh noise and the presure is going down from 12 psi to 8 or 9 psi and go back to 12 psi and start over and over again. HELP ME PLEASE !!

Sounds like one of the sieve beds has a sticking dump valve.

But it would be best to have it looked at in person or at least have someone one on the phone who knows them well go over it with you.
